The Review Score of 9.9 (9.881) out of 10 for Kind Hearts Care Company is based on a) the Average Rating and b) the number of positive Reviews.
The maximum Review Score for a Home Care Provider is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:
The 5 points available are broken down as follows: 3 points for the first Positive Review, 2 points in total for each of the next 9 Positive Reviews (1st = 3, 2nd = 0.5, 3rd = 0.5, 4th = 0.25, 5th = 0.25, 6th = 0.1, 7th = 0.1, 8th = 0.1, 9th = 0.1, 10th = 0.1)

Originally planning to be a hairdresser, I found, while studying at Guildford College, I very much enjoyed the older ladies who came to have their hair done. After completing my hairdressing NVQ, I decided to try care work and I absolutely loved it. I worked for a fantastic company that set a great example of how care should be delivered; completely personalised with compassion, care and respect. I worked at this company for 7 years until it was unfortunately bought out.
Over the years I have built my business knowledge in many different ways from running a breakfast and after-school club with children to founding, growing and solely running a netball club for 15 years consisting of 250 members at its peak.
Covid was and continues to be an extremely hard time for a lot of people. For me, it meant I was not able to continue with netball due to the lockdowns. After a break, this is what led me back into the care sector, I remembered exactly why I loved it so much. I have a strong belief that if you are not doing something that makes a difference in people’s lives, there is no point in doing it. I thrive from making a difference, making people happy and enabling them to live the best life possible and continuing to work to maintain it for as long as possible. I have a real sense that this is what I was put on the planet to do.
Working for many different care companies over the years, I wanted to take all of the good points I have seen and put them all together in one place. Ensuring that care is delivered completely personalised to the service user, that healthcare assistants are well looked after and that everyone involved in the company feels a sense of belonging and is part of something special, whilst developing the company to have a strong reputation for being of the highest quality and standard.
I still go out and deliver care when required, all my service users know me well, both for fun and laughter but also for acting on anything that may need changing or addressing in their care package. They understand completely that I am a perfectionist and will be proactive in ensuring that their care package is perfect for them.
